Umm a slight misunderstanding here - XP Home edition comes with Outlook
Express. Outlook, (NOT Outlook Express) comes as an integral part of Office.
Office does NOT come with Outlook Express - it was already there in your
operating system. In fact it is still there - you cannot remove it in XP. If
you want to have OE as the default mail client, go to Control Panel.
Internet Options-Programs and re-set OE as the default. (Outlook has a habit
of automatically re-setting the Default Email client to itself!)
